Byline: John Leusch Daily Herald Sports Writer About 10 years ago, Prospect senior Kelly Cummings and her sister Meghan would head to Loyola University to watch their older sister Kim play softball for the Division I program in Chicago. "Our mom (Joan, who played basketball at DePaul) used to take us to all her games," Kelly said.
"Megan and I would chase foul balls and play catch. We always had a good time when we went to watch Kim's games." Joan and her husband Tom now have a second Division I softball player in their family, but they'll have to venture a lot farther to watch their current softball standout.
